Ayurveda is a holistic system that's been around for 5,000 years and addresses the whole human being and root causes that are causing imbalance, not just the symptoms.
Ayurveda means the study of life. It can help lead oneself back to their innate wisdom and connection to nature via:
•The 5 senses
•The 6 tastes
•Our daily habits
•How and when we're exercising
•Understanding the five elements that make up everything (earth, water, fire, air, and ether).
